Summary
$100 million in six days made "Backrooms" A24's highest-grossing domestic release, overtaking "Marty Supreme" at $96 million.
Kane Parsons' film arrived with heavy anticipation, critical acclaim and a built-in audience from the viral internet phenomenon and his YouTube shorts that inspired the feature.
Parsons, now 20, was tapped by A24 after creating the "Backrooms" shorts as a teenager, underscoring how YouTube-grown creators are driving current horror hits.
The breakout run has already put sequel plans in view and adds to evidence that low-budget, online-native horror can reshape what Hollywood backs.
